    On this episode of Positioning to Profit, host Patty Dominguez interviews Aleasha Bahr, a natural salesperson, about effective sales strategies and determining client fit. Aleasha acknowledges the concerns and fears surrounding spending money and emphasizes the importance of addressing these concerns in an open conversation with prospects. They discuss framing the decision-making process in a way that empowers prospects to evaluate their options and understand their alternative plans. Aleasha believes in telling prospects when they are not a good fit for a product or service, as this builds trust, leads to return customers and referrals, and prevents time and energy drain. They compare the process of determining a fit to dating, emphasizing the need for specific questions and a deep diagnostic process. Aleasha also shares the importance of checking questions, form applications, and pre-framing conversations to filter out non-serious prospects and avoid wasted time. They discuss the importance of having a structure for sales conversations and focusing on how the solution solves the client's issue rather than giving advice. Aleasha also criticizes inauthentic marketing strategies and praises a hope-based approach. They believe in knowing the challenges but focusing on positive aspects and empathizing with negative experiences. The episode ends with Aleasha expressing excitement for the listener to have a positive experience with someone who supports them.
